Frequently asked questions about accommodations in Normandy

  • What are the must-see attractions in Normandy, France?

    Normandy offers a wealth of attractions. For history buffs, the D-Day landing beaches (Omaha, Utah, Juno, Sword, and Gold beaches) and the American Cemetery at Colleville-sur-Mer are essential. The Bayeux Tapestry, depicting the Norman Conquest of England, is a masterpiece. Mont Saint-Michel, a breathtaking tidal island monastery, is another iconic sight. The charming cities of Rouen, with its stunning cathedral, and Caen, with its castle, are also well worth exploring.
  • Are there any seasonal events or cultural festivals in Normandy, France?

    Normandy hosts various events throughout the year. The Arromanches 360° cinema, commemorating the D-Day landings, is open year-round. Many towns and villages hold local fêtes during the summer months, often celebrating regional produce or local crafts. The Mémorial de Caen, a museum dedicated to peace and war, hosts temporary exhibitions.
  • What are the most characteristic landscapes and terrains found in Normandy, France?

    Normandy's landscapes are diverse. The coastline features dramatic cliffs, sandy beaches, and estuaries. Inland, you'll find rolling hills, picturesque farmland, and the Pays d'Auge, known for its bocage (hedged fields). The Seine River valley provides fertile plains and charming riverside towns. The cliffs of Étretat are a particularly stunning example of Normandy's dramatic coastline.
  • What are the best outdoor activities in Normandy, France?

    Normandy is ideal for outdoor pursuits. Hiking and cycling are popular, particularly along the coastal paths and through the bocage countryside. Kayaking or paddleboarding on the Seine River or along the coast is another option. Horse riding is also available in many areas, and the beaches are perfect for swimming and sunbathing during the summer months.
  • What is the best time of year to visit Normandy, France with kids?

    Summer (June to August) offers the warmest weather, perfect for beach days and outdoor activities. However, it's also the busiest and most expensive time to visit. Spring (April to May) and autumn (September to October) provide pleasant temperatures and fewer crowds, making them excellent alternatives for families.
  • Are there any local customs to be aware of in Normandy, France?

    Normandy is generally quite relaxed, but it's polite to greet people with 'Bonjour' and 'Au revoir'. In smaller villages, taking the time to engage in conversation and show respect for the local culture is appreciated. Many shops and businesses will close for a few hours in the afternoon, a common practice in France.
  • What are the best ways to interact with locals and learn about their culture in Normandy, France?

    Visiting local markets is a great way to interact with Normans and sample regional produce. Staying in smaller, family-run hotels or guesthouses can provide opportunities for conversation. Taking a guided tour focusing on local history and culture can also offer insights into the region's traditions. Learning a few basic French phrases will greatly enhance your interactions.
  • What are some lesser-known attractions or hidden gems in Normandy, France?

    Beyond the major sites, explore the charming villages of the Pays d'Auge, such as Beuvron-en-Auge. Visit the Château de Fontaine-Henry, a stunning Renaissance château. Explore the natural beauty of the Marais du Cotentin et du Bessin, a vast wetland area teeming with wildlife. The cliffs of Pointe du Hoc offer a less-visited but equally significant D-Day site.
  • What are the must-try local dishes in Normandy, France?

    Normandy is renowned for its cuisine. Mussels are a staple, often served in a creamy sauce. Try the local cider, Calvados (apple brandy), and Camembert cheese. Andouillette (a type of sausage) and tripes à la mode de Caen (tripe) are more adventurous options. Seafood is abundant and delicious, reflecting Normandy's coastal location. Don't forget to sample the local bread and pastries.
